What to Do After a Bus Accident: A Step-by-Step Guide

When a bus accident happens, it can be a chaotic and traumatic experience for everyone involved. Knowing what to do in the aftermath of a bus accident can help ensure that you and others involved receive the necessary medical care and that your legal rights are protected.

Here is a step-by-step guide on what to do after a bus accident:

  1. Check for injuries: The first and most important step after a bus accident is to check yourself and others for injuries. Call 911 immediately if anyone is seriously injured and requires medical attention. It is also important to move to a safe location to avoid any further accidents or hazards.
  2. Contact the authorities: After checking for injuries, call the police and report the accident. This is necessary to ensure that an official accident report is created, which can be useful later on when dealing with insurance companies or seeking legal action.
  3. Exchange information: If possible, exchange information with the bus driver and other parties involved in the accident. This includes names, contact information, insurance information, and the license plate numbers of all vehicles involved.
  4. Collect evidence: Take pictures and videos of the accident scene, including any damage to vehicles and injuries to passengers. This can be useful evidence for insurance companies and attorneys.
  5. Gather witness information: If there were any witnesses to the accident, collect their names and contact information. They may be able to provide important details about the accident that can be helpful later on.
  6. Seek medical attention: Even if you do not feel injured, it is important to seek medical attention as soon as possible. Some injuries, such as whiplash or concussions, may not be immediately apparent but can cause long-term health problems if left untreated.
  7. Notify your insurance company: Contact your insurance company as soon as possible to report the accident. Provide them with all the necessary information, including the police report, witness statements, and pictures or videos of the accident scene.
  8. Contact a bus accident attorney: If you or someone else was injured in the bus accident, it is important to contact a bus accident attorney. An experienced attorney can help protect your legal rights and seek compensation for your injuries and damages.
  9. Keep records: Keep detailed records of all medical treatment, including doctor’s visits, tests, and medication. Also, keep a record of any expenses related to the accident, including medical bills, lost wages, and property damage.
  10. Be cautious when dealing with insurance companies: Insurance companies are often focused on protecting their own interests and may try to settle for less than you deserve. It is important to be cautious when dealing with insurance companies and to seek the advice of an experienced attorney before accepting any settlement offers.
